Tha Carter II is a southern classic imo, from the production, lyricism, album structure, It's just a well put together album. Managed to keep the filler to a minimum and even then, filler tracks wern't drowned in auto-tune. Still listen to it every few weeks, It's literally in rotation year round.

Tha Carter III on the other hand is awful with little-no highlights such as Dr. Carter. None the less, this is a business, and he sold alot of records on the strengh of songs the general public loves, which in turn brought down the quality of his album.

When you go from 'Fireman' & 'Hustler Musik' to 'Lollipop' & 'Got Money', there's something wrong.
